jQuery MiniUI

标题: 页面参数传递 [打印本页]

作者: panepan    时间: 2019-11-23 10:53:11     标题: 页面参数传递

本帖最后由 panepan 于 2019-11-23 10:54 编辑

目前官方的传递参数都是使用的mini.open弹出一个新窗口,但如果是使用类似于官方的http://www.miniui.com/demo/outlooktree/outlooktree.htmloutlooktree框架,点击修改需要在右侧的tabs动态新增一个页面(而非弹出一个页面)并传递相关参数,应该如何动态新增页面后并传递指定参数?

作者: dforce    时间: 2019-11-25 09:18:46

  1. function showTab(node) {
  2.             var tabs = mini.get("mainTabs");

  3.             var id = "tab$" + node.id;
  4.             var tab = tabs.getTab(id);
  5.             if (!tab) {
  6.                 tab = {};
  7.                 tab._nodeid = node.id;
  8.                 tab.name = id;
  9.                 tab.title = node.text;
  10.                 tab.showCloseButton = true;

  11.                 //这里拼接了url,实际项目,应该从后台直接获得完整的url地址
  12.                 tab.url = mini_JSPath + "../../docs/api/" + node.id + ".html";
  13.                 tab.onload=function(){
  14.                          //这里可以带上tab加载完毕的回调函数
  15.                 }
  16.                 tabs.addTab(tab);
  17.             }
  18.             tabs.activeTab(tab);
  19.         }
复制代码





欢迎光临 jQuery MiniUI (http://miniui.com/discuss/) Powered by Discuz! X2